During our snowboarding lessons, you will be part of small groups of up to 8 participants, allowing for personalised guidance from our experienced instructors. First-timers will learn essential skills such as balancing, gliding, and getting comfortable with their equipment. For beginners, the focus will be on heel and toe drifting, turning, and mastering the chairlift – all crucial for building confidence on the slopes. Intermediate riders will practice skid turns and begin to explore the basics of carving, while advanced participants will refine their carving skills and delve into freeride and freestyle techniques.

We meet at the parking lot, right at the foot of the slopes, 10 minutes before the start of the lesson. You will be able to recognize our ski instructors by their marine-blue jacket, with "Skicenter" written on the back.
All participants need a ski pass from the first day of the lessons. You can buy your ski pass at the ski lift ticket office or online before the first lesson.
In order to not lose time at the beginning of your lesson, please buy your ski pass in advance.
If you book your ski pass with Skicenter, we offer two easy options: Delivery to your accommodation: we’ll bring your passes the afternoon before, so they’re ready to use. Pick-up at our office: your passes will be prepared in advance, so you don’t need to queue or buy anything extra — they’re ready to go.
